After a protracted battle with cancer, Anna Lopez, age 57, died on November 9, 2016 in Grand Junction, CO at the age of 57.

Anna was born on September 11, 1959 in Grand Junction, Colorado to Sonny and Earleen Marshall.  Anna grew up in Grand Junction and attended Grand Junction High School.  She married John Lopez in April of 1979, moving to the small mountain community of Collbran, Colorado soon after.  Anna was an active and dedicated member of the local community.  She owned several small businesses, volunteered regularly, and served as a volunteer Firefighter and First Responder for more than 10 years.  Anna’s drive for life, mental and emotional strength, and dedication to family will live on through her four children, three grandchildren, and all of those who were fortunate enough to know her.

Anna enjoyed photography, bowling, camping, reading, and traveling.  She expressed her creative side through less traditional artistic avenues.  She was an adventurous cook, always experimenting with new foods and recipes; she had her own unique style of dress that was unmistakably her own; and she enjoyed several creative outlets that range from cake decorating to Pysanka, a traditional Ukrainian craft.
